“DEVELOPING MY NEW LIFE RELATIONSHIPS: The Book Of Revelation”

Bible Fact: The Book of Revelation is given by Jesus and written by John to strengthen our hope of the future.

Bible Text: Revelation 1:1; Matthew 24:1-51

Aim:To help students to become aware of what to expect in time and eternality to come.

The Things Hereafter: Chapter 21 (Part 2)

I. A New Day For A New Life

A. The Holy City’s descriptions as John saw it:

  1. Has the glory of God v.11a
  2. Her light was like a jasper v.11b
  3. A high wall v.12a
  4. Twelve gates and twelve names vv.12b,13
  5. Names on the wall v.14
  6. The golden reed v.15
  7. Jerusalem – A four square city vv.16,17
  8. A city of rich and regal beauty vv.18-21
  9. No church building there v.22
  10. The Lamb is the light v.23
  11. Only holy traffic there vv.24,26
  12. No security needed v.25
  13. Righteous admissions only v.27
